Sons of Lost Souls

  SOLS

Calendar

Sat. 1/25 5:00 PM crew vs crew battle
1 ... 59 60 61
Show Upcoming Events

Oops! This site has expired.

If you are the site owner, please renew your premium subscription or contact support.